WebJul 19, 2024 · The Crickets were originally formed in May 1957 as an alias for Buddy Holly. Holly had recorded the song That’ll Be The Day several months earlier as a solo artist for Decca Records. Even though his contract with Decca ended in January 1957, he was legally prohibited from re-recording any of his Decca material for five years. WebApr 3, 2013 · The Crickettes playing "Ghost Riders In The Sky" in the style of The Spotnicks at The Pipeline Instrumental Music Convention 2013 The Crickets were an American rock and roll band from Lubbock, Texas, formed by singer-songwriter Buddy Holly in January 1957. Their first hit record, "That'll Be the Day", released in May 1957, peaked at number three on the Billboard Top 100 chart on September 16, 1957. WebFeb 7, 2024 · After Buddy Holly left the Crickets, it was business as usual for the band, which added a couple of new members following their original singer's departure — singer-guitarist Sonny Curtis (pictured above at left) and lead vocalist Earl Sinks.
